Cupid is a symbol of love and desire in Roman mythology. He is often depicted as a winged infant with a bow and arrow, which he uses to strike people and make them fall in love. In popular culture, Cupid is often associated with Valentine's Day and is seen as a matchmaking figure who brings couples together.
Cupid is traditionally depicted as hitting the heart with his arrow to cause love and affection for another person.
